WebOct 30, 2013 · A functionally complete set of logical connectives is one which can be used to express all possible truth tables by combining members of the set into a Boolean … WebFunctional completeness [ edit] Main article: NOR logic The NOR gate has the property of functional completeness, which it shares with the NAND gate. That is, any other logic function (AND, OR, etc.) can be implemented using only NOR gates. The NAND Boolean function has the property of functional completeness. This means that any Boolean expression can be re-expressed by an equivalent expression utilizing only NAND operations. For example, the function NOT (x) may be equivalently expressed as NAND (x,x).
